Output 85dc823056f5778367e965bad8c74d28b3fad5e0f340acc88adfc0e9ac9c186a:6

value
39963842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f0e3ab91675b66a94143e56499abf5470d1ac5c OP_EQUAL
address
3DGpnafsovegbU8QxBVXz5JR6Tn5eNGXcA
transaction
85dc823056f5778367e965bad8c74d28b3fad5e0f340acc88adfc0e9ac9c186a
spent
true